Verizon Outage Affecting All US Customers Roaming Abroad

Just wanted to call this to the attention of the group. According to X, its been going on for a while ~24hrs. "@VerizonSupport 47m Replying to @ApolloPappas We're sorry about the issues you're having with service. There's a current outage for all international customers. For me personally, and others traveling in my vicinity, this outage has been resolved. It appears that Syniverse was responsible for the outage; they have released a statement which, according to my experience, somewhat understates the extent of the trouble: https://www.syniverse.com/news-and-events/statement-from-syniverse-regarding... Just had a colleague land in Paris. He’s on AT&T and says it’s much worse than being reported. He scrambled to get an E-SIM from a local company just for basic options. No bars at all without it. I live in Paris, and traveled to Luxembourg and the Netherlands in the last week… My Free eSIM had solidly consistent data roaming in both LU and NL (and works fine at home in Paris), but my T-Mobile eSIM has been intermittent, sometimes working for a while, but then not for hours at a time. I also normally get an SMS from T-Mobile immediately when I enter a new country, and that didn’t seem to be happening reliably either.
